Presentation of the project "Living with Urticaria: a story for cares quality" at EAACI Congress 2015

Immagine ortica-piccolaThe project “Living with Urticaria: a story for cares quality” was conducted by the Health and Well-Being Area of ISTUD Foundation, to understand the needs of people who live everyday with chronic urticaria and to improve quality of offered care services. From June to November 2014 have been collected more than 150 stories of people who live with this difficult disease.

The project will be presented by Maria Giulia Marini at EAACI Congress, that will take place in Barcelona (Spain) from 6-10 June 2015. The Congress is organised by the European Academy of Allergy and Clinical Immunology (EAACI) and offers a unique opportunity to learn about new discoveries and exchange experience with professionals in the field of allergy and clinical immunology.

The presentation of the project will take place on 9th june at 3.30 pm, during the Oral Abstract Session 35 “Contact dermatitis and urticaria”.
